You'll "BE AMAZED" by this quirky, off-beat, modern comedy by Kevin
Kling. Bob, a boy raised by raccoons, is adopted by a mother who
runs away with her therapist and a father whose smile incites fear
and violence in the boy. Abandoned as quickly as he is adopted,
Bob meets Lloyd, an ex-con and huckster who turns first to a sideshow,
then to religion as a means of earning a quick buck off of "Bob
the Beast Boy." Only an intervention from The Angel of the Lord
can help these two unlikely friends find their hearts and learn
to "BE AMAZED."
Most enjoyable for mature audiences; adult situations and themes;
parental guidance recommended for children under 13.
